The toe guard protects the toes from falling objects and pinching. Meets the requirements of standard EN ISO 20345:2011: impact resistance is 200 J and compression force resistance is 15,000 N. Aluminum toe protection is 50% lighter than traditional steel toe protection.
The steel nail penetration protection prevents sharp objects from penetrating through the base. Meets the requirements of standard 20345:2011: nail penetration resistance is 1100 N.
The sole of the footwear consists of polyurethane and rubber. The PU/rubber friction sole has excellent grip and wear resistance properties. The middle layer of the sole is shock-absorbing FlexStep® material. Heat resistance up to 300 °C.
The heel elastic protects the feet and supporting organs from strain. Meets the requirements of the standards EN ISO 20345:2011 and EN ISO 20347:2012: the shock absorption of the footwear is at least 20 J. The microporous FlexStep® sole material developed by Sievi retains its excellent shock absorption and flexibility even in freezing conditions. The sole of the shoe stays softer even in severe frost and maintains grip on slippery surfaces. The entire structure of the FlexStep® flexible sole prevents stress and shocks on the legs and spine, and helps prevent leg and back pain and thus improves work efficiency. Footwear equipped with an antistatic structure discharges static electricity accumulated in the body in a controlled manner. The resistance limit values are 100 kΩ to 1000 MΩ.
The Sievi ALU insole has a heat-insulating aluminum layer. The aluminum foil of the insole reflects cold outside and heat inside.
The footwear uses a water-repellent upper material. Water penetration resistance meets the requirements of standard EN ISO 20345:2011.
Footwear with this symbol is resistant to oil and many chemicals. Oil resistance meets the requirements of the EN ISO 20345:2011 standard.
